Grammy: How Kendrick Lamar Surpasses Jay-Z As Most-Awarded Rapper

Kendrick Lamar swept the rap categories at the 68th Annual Grammy Awards on Sunday, winning all four.

His album ‘GNX’ won the Best Rap Album, while his collaboration with Lefty Gunplay, ‘TV Off’ clinched the Best Rap Song.

His SZA-assisted hit, ‘Luther’, won the Best Melodic Rap Performance while his collaboration with Clipse, ‘Chains & Whips,’ took home the Best Rap Performance award.

‘Luther’ also won the highly coveted Record of the Year award.

After sweeping the rap categories and also winning the Record of the Year at this year’s Grammys, Lamar surpassed Jay-Z (25) as the most-awarded rapper, with 27 Grammys.

Meanwhile, Olivia Dean won the Best New Artist at the 2026 Grammy, beating stiff competition from Leon Thomas, KATSEYE, Addison Rae, and Lola Young.

Dean continued the streak of only women winning Best New Artist at the Grammys since 2017.

Billie Eilish won the Song of the Year for ‘Wildflower’ for a record time.

Puerto Rican singer Bad Bunny’s ‘Debí Tirar Más Fotos’ makes history as the first Spanish-language ‘Album of the Year’ winner in Grammys history.

Pharrell Williams received the Dr Dre Global Impact award at this year’s Grammys.

Beyoncé remains the most awarded artist in Grammy history, with 35 wins.
